Output 255ca2885ab9d2702f37e0bae7ddf6fb166cde514007b5c4c4107a7931c1923c:2

value
10581089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93f1e2d3bc393b5a5695cb8d20db40e69545b3a5 OP_EQUAL
address
MMPRLAbJyC7e2Z6hJfnBsQt87Bt9Zzjucs
transaction
255ca2885ab9d2702f37e0bae7ddf6fb166cde514007b5c4c4107a7931c1923c
spent
true